Industrial roof replacement services involve the removal and installation of new roofing systems on large commercial and industrial properties. This process typically starts with a thorough assessment of the existing roof to determine its condition and the scope of work needed. Once the assessment is complete, contractors will remove the old roofing material, address any underlying structural issues, and then install a new, durable roofing system designed to meet the specific needs of the property. These services often include the use of specialized equipment and techniques to ensure a proper fit and long-lasting performance.
This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or damaged roofs, such as leaks, punctures, and structural deterioration.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ause roofing materials to weaken, leading to water intrusion and potential damage to the interior of the building. An industrial roof replacement can prevent further deterioration, protect the building’s contents, and improve energy efficiency by installing modern, better-insulating roofing materials. This process can also address issues caused by improper previous installations or outdated roofing systems that no longer meet current standards.

The overview below groups typical Industrial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Birmingham,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for industrial roof replacement typ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of material chosen, such as metal or membrane. For a 10,000-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ary from $30,000 to $80,000.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ing an industrial roof gener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ot, influenced by project complexity and location. For a standard 10,000-square-foot roof, labor charges may range from $20,000 to $50,000.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ses like permits, equipment rentals, or roof insulation can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These costs can increase the total project budget by several thousand dollars depending on specific requirements.
Project Total - Overall, the total cost for industrial roof replacement in Birmingham, NJ, typically ranges from $50,000 to $150,000 for a standard-sized project. Variations depend on roof size, materials, and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that an industrial roof needs replacement? Common indicators include persistent leaks, extensive roof damage, visible sagging, or significant wear and tear that cannot be repaired effectively.
How long does an industrial ro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most projects are completed within a few days to a week.
What types of roofing materials are used for industrial roof replacements? Common materials include metal panels, built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and single-ply membranes, selected based on durability and suitability for the building.
Are there any permits required for industrial roof replacement? Permit requirements depend on local regulations; it is advisable to consult with local contractors or authorities to ensure compliance.
What maintenance is recommended after an industrial roof replacement? Regular inspections, cleaning of drainage systems, and prompt repairs of minor damages can help extend the lifespan of the new roof.
